I have this problem using a Weintek eMT3150A HMI having the following I/O ports:
I/O Port
SD Card Slot SD/SDHC
USB Host USB 2.0 x 1
USB Client USB 2.0 x 1
Ethernet 10/100 Base-T
COM Port
COM1 (RS-232/RS-485 2W/4W),
COM3(RS-232/RS-485 2W)
CAN Bus Yes
Audio Audio Line Out - 3.5 mm jack x 1
Video Input Port NTSC/PAL RCA x 2
We need to make a log file file based on sensor readings and access these data later with a remote PC application.
I was wondering if anybody would have an idea on how to acheive such a thing?
So far we figured out that we could use an event log, sampling data, recipe database, or operation log to external device (USB disk / SD card / remote backup server / send through email with attachment.
We are particulary interested in the remote "backup server option". This could be the PC which contain the software that needs to access the log file we would have previously created then synchronized with the sensor readings.
OR
We could have the remote PC accessing the SD card on the HMI which contains the log file.
Would the be any command in prompt that allow access to this SD card on the HMI? From what we understand, the HMI uses MODBUS TCP/IP.
